L-(+)-arabinose is a naturally occurring pentose sugar (C5H10O5, MW 150.13 g/mol) provided as an analytical/reference standard for research and quality control. Supplied as a white to off-white crystalline powder, it is used in method development, calibration of chromatographic and spectrometric assays, enzyme activity studies, and carbohydrate metabolism research. High purity and small packaged quantities make it suitable for laboratory calibration and validation workflows.
